開始發問
0

自定義Unicode造字(Private User Areas)無法正確顯示 [已關閉]

提問於 2019-12-26 08:00:43 +0100

teeeed 大頭貼

updated 2019-12-31 08:55:09 +0100

安裝全字庫後,使用自定義Unicode造字在LibreOffice無法正常顯示,但在其他編輯器(記事本)是正常的,如所示。

編輯 重新標籤 舉報濫用 打開 合併 刪除

因為下面原因關閉 問題已經解決,已得到正確答案teeeed
關閉日期 2019-12-31 11:17:08.389346

評論

字型用新細明體這樣可以嗎?

Franklin Weng 大頭貼Franklin Weng ( 2019-12-28 00:55:22 +0100 )編輯

用新細明體也不行,目前測試狀況是只要輸入的是Unicode自造字,在LibreOffice就無法正常顯示(會顯示為別的字,但使用Alt+X檢視Unicode編碼是對的;複製該顯示錯誤的字再貼到記事本中,在記事本中顯示也會是正常的)謝謝~

teeeed 大頭貼teeeed ( 2019-12-30 07:20:15 +0100 )編輯

我的意思是截圖中看到的字型是新細明體,但自定義的字(編碼也是自定義?)新細明體裡肯定不會有吧?

Franklin Weng 大頭貼Franklin Weng ( 2019-12-31 07:43:06 +0100 )編輯

是的,編碼也是自定義的,會定在E000~F8FF之間。以全字庫(它有提供標楷體、新細明體、細明體字型)安裝後就有的自造字測試。在Word中切換標楷體、新細明體、細明體都可以正常顯示,在LibreOffice切換上述三種字型都無法正常顯示,但同一個Unicode自造字,切換字型後顯示的都是同一個錯字。 Unicode自造字於Word和LibreOffice Writer顯示截圖

teeeed 大頭貼teeeed ( 2019-12-31 08:17:06 +0100 )編輯
1

謝謝F大跟I大回答。剛在英文版得到答案,把字型檔放到Program Files\LibreOffice\share\fonts\truetype(沒有的話就新建資料夾)裡就OK了

teeeed 大頭貼teeeed ( 2019-12-31 11:15:24 +0100 )編輯

請將答案放進答案區,以供其他人參考。謝謝!

Franklin Weng 大頭貼Franklin Weng ( 2020-01-01 07:35:07 +0100 )編輯
0

已回答 2019-12-30 17:41:31 +0100

我不知道如我截圖所示的用字是否是你需要的?如果是的話,請參考如下網址 https://www.cns11643.gov.tw/wordView.... 也就是全字庫早已收錄,而且也收錄在unicode正編碼範圍內,不需要自造字。影像描述

編輯 舉報濫用 刪除 連結 更多

評論

抱歉,我舉了個不好的例子。 實際遇到的情況不侷限於該字「个」,使用者會使用其他全字庫Unicode自造字,如有需要也會自行造字,所以希望Unicode自造字能正常顯示,謝謝您的回覆

teeeed 大頭貼teeeed ( 2019-12-31 07:54:27 +0100 )編輯

剛在英文版得到答案,把字型檔放到Program Files\LibreOffice\share\fonts\truetype(沒有的話就新建資料夾)裡就OK了

teeeed 大頭貼teeeed ( 2020-01-03 03:47:23 +0100 )編輯

提問工具

1 位粉絲

統計

已提問: 2019-12-26 08:00:43 +0100

已讀: 18 次

最後更新時間: Dec 31 '19